Proportional – Integral – Derivatives control scheme is used to provide an efficient and quiet easier in control engineering applications. Most of the Conventional PID tuning methods are used in manually which is difficult and time consuming. Soft Computing Technique is used to overcome this problem by using Fuzzy logic technique. In this research focuses dynamic performance specification is such as rise time, settling time and peak over shoot. This paper proposes to compare conventional and non-conventional techniques and the result of this comparison, The non-conventional technique (Fuzzy logic) has optimal dynamic performance. The plant model is represented by the transfer function, is obtained by the system identification tool box.
